Job Description

Within Fixed and Mobile Access Operation, this role is managing Vodafone Italy RAN operation & maintenance tasks within the RAN 2nd level support team. The 2nd level support engineer is supposed to trouble-shoot RAN issues, to apply procedures and changes meant to restore the service, to support remotely field engineer on complex troubleshooting, to manage 3rd level vendors support, to follow-up problem management with vendors, to execute planned works, including configuration changes or software upgrades on RAN nodes. The role requires technical expertise on RAN technologies, and at the same time know-how on processes such as incident management, problem management and change management, as well as knowledge of all security policies concerning user access management, patching and hardening related to RAN nodes
